which of the following is a characteristic of cephalopods?
dozens-spider like feet
long claws
tentacles attached to the head
a single, big foot
Answer: tentacles attached to the head
Explanation:
Cephalopoda simply refers to "head foot". The cephalopods is also known as a form of invertebrates that possess a very complex brain.
Cephalopods have a head and foot that is joined together with the head being surrounded by tentacles. Therefore, the correct answer is "tentacles attached to their head".

There are three different ways that balance is used IN ART. Please list the three different ways and explain what each means.
Answer:
symmetrical, asymmetrical, and radial.
Explanation:
Symmetrical: means that the work of art is the same on one side as the other, a mirror image of itself, on both sides of a center line.
Asymmetrical: means that the two halves of the work of art are different, however, try to create balance.
Radial: balance relates to elements that spread out from a central point.

What is jazz?
Jazz is a musical genre that emerged in the late 19th and early 20th century in the United States, particularly in New Orleans. It is characterized by its improvisational nature, rhythmic complexity, and a strong sense of swing or groove. Jazz incorporates elements from various musical traditions, including African, European, and American music, and often features a combination of instruments such as horns, piano, bass, drums, and guitar. Jazz has been highly influential in shaping popular music and culture, and has inspired many other genres such as rock, hip-hop, and electronic music.
Jazz musicians often work within a specific harmonic and rhythmic framework, but are encouraged to experiment and create their own interpretations of melodies and harmonies. Improvisation is a fundamental aspect of jazz, and allows musicians to showcase their technical abilities, creativity, and individuality.
